WHITE CHOCOLATE DIPPED CRANBERRY PECAN OATMEAL COOKIES..




I found this idea on Pinterest and had to re create it, and they taste so amazing. They're super easy to do..

Ingredients..
1 3/4 cups of plain flour
1/2 tsp baking powder
3/4 cup of brown sugar
1/4 tsp cinnamon
1/2 cup of sugar
2 big bars of white chocolate 
2 tsp vanilla extract 
1 1/2 cups cranberries 
1 egg
1 1/2 cup oats 
1/2 cup pecans 
1 cup salted butter 

1. Preheat oven to 180
2. Beat butter and sugars together until well combined.
3. Add egg and vanilla extract and mix until well combined.
4. Add flour, baking soda, baking powder and cinnamon and mix until well combined.
5. Add oats and mix until a thick dough forms.
6. Stir in cranberries and pecan pieces.
7. Place heaping tablespoon-sized balls of cookie dough onto a parchment lined cookie sheet.
8. Bake 8-9 minutes. Cookies may look a little undercooked in the center, but the continue to cook and firm as they cool. Do not over bake. If cookies look cooked (not a little undercooked) when you take them out, they are probably overcooked.
9. Let cookies cool for about 2 minutes on the cookie sheet, then remove to cooling rack to finish cooling.
10. Once cookies are cool, melt white chocolate in a small bowl.
11. Dip cookies, one at a time, into white chocolate and shake to remove excess. Set on parchment paper to dry. Sprinkle with crushed pecans before the candiquick dries, if desired.
